x^4 + x^2 + 1 = (x^2 + x + 1)(x^2 - x + 1) To find this, first notice that x^4 + x^2 + 1 > 0 for all (real) values of x. So there are no linear factors, only quadratic ones. x^4 + x^2 + 1 = (ax^2 + bx + c)(dx^2 + ex + f) Without bothering to multiply this out fully just yet, notice that the coefficient of x^4 gives us ad = 1. The series has also been criticised for …Example: Factor 6x^2 + 19x + 10. 6*10 = 60, so we need to find two numbers that add to 19 and multiply to give 60. These numbers (after some trial and error) are 15 and 4.
